Q. & A. with Naira and Pia

  • Why did you start breeding?

    Our parents were avid Rottweiler lovers who then became breeders, focusing primarily on temperament. We have worked in high tech, and were small business owners, but once our families started to grow we stayed home and focused on our kids and pups.​ ​
  • What makes your program special?

    Our mission is to breed healthy, intelligent puppies empowering them for their future who can bring happiness and love from our family to yours.
  • What are the different breed sizes in your program?

    Our Cavapoo puppies are miniature size. Australian Labradoodle puppies include miniature and medium sizes. Sizes will vary depending on the parent dogs.
  • What are the different breed coat colors in your program?

    Australian Labradoodle puppies include caramel cream, caramel, caramel red, red, apricot, cream, chocolate, and black. Colors will vary depending on the parent dogs.
  • Where do your breeding dogs live?

    They live in my home and guardian homes.

Breeder-Reported Testing

Great level

Loving Labradoodle reports to performing the health tests below on their breeding dogs. Ask your breeder about the tests performed on the parents of your litter. Learn more about health testing for Australian Labradoodles.

  • Hip Dysplasia (Preliminary), Hip Dysplasia

    Hip testing reduces the chance of passing down hip dysplasia, which is primarily found in large breed dogs and can cause hip pain and the eventual loss of the function of the hip joint.

  • Elbow Dysplasia Finals (OFA, BVA, SV, FCI), Elbow Dysplasia (Preliminary)

    Elbow testing reduces the chance of passing down elbow dysplasia, which is primarily found in large breed dogs and can cause arthritis in the elbow joint and front leg lameness.

  • Cardiac Evaluation (rDVM, not registered with OFA)

    Heart testing reduces the chance of passing down congenital heart disease, which can cause a range of symptoms ranging from trouble exercising to heart failure.

  • Exercise Induced Collapse (EIC), PRA, Rod-Cone Degeneration (PRA-prcd), Full Embark Panel

    Genetic testing reduces the chance of passing down a wide variety of hereditary diseases of differing prevalence and severity such as Progressive Retinal Atrophy (an eye disease) and Von Willebrand's Disease (a blood disease).
